Ethiopia formally declares battle on Tigray forces

The province of Tigray is situated in northern Ethiopia, on the border with Eritrea. The offensive was launched by Ethiopian Prime Minister Abiy Ahmed on Tuesday evening to Wednesday, November 4, to regain management of the province that desires to secede. An offensive that he intends to proceed. All communication continues to be reduce with Tigray. Tough for the time being to ascertain an evaluation of the matches.

It’s really troublesome to know the extent of the losses on either side. It is usually troublesome to obviously see the precise course of the matches because of the reduce in communication.

What we do know, nevertheless, is that the clashes are happening primarily alongside the border between the provinces of Tigray and Amhara, 400 kilometers lengthy, with heavy preventing, particularly close to the Sudanese border.

Generals withdrew, battle machines captured by the Tigraian authorities

Within the afternoon of Thursday, November 5, planes have been heard within the Tigrayan sky. Numerous sources report bombing with out realizing the precise goal. Some speak about Mekele, the provincial capital, others speak about navy positions of the TPLF (Entrance for Liberation of the Folks of Tigray) occasion on the outskirts of Mekele.

Troop actions have additionally been noticed from numerous Ethiopian areas to strengthen the federal contingent on the outskirts of Tigray. As well as, three former generals have been requested to retire on Wednesday to return and assist the nationwide military.

In Mekele, the Tigraian authorities claimed to have seized artillery items and tanks belonging to the division stationed within the metropolis. “We’ll destroy whoever is attempting to assault us,” the president of the province mentioned.
